The MAURINAPHTE I is a products tanker built in 1982, with a deadweight tonnage (DWT) of 6,739 tonnes and a length overall (LOA) of 110.85 meters. Designed with a double bottom hull for improved safety, it is currently trading under the Nigerian flag. The vessel's specifications indicate suitability for transporting refined products, with a gross tonnage of 4,489 and net tonnage of 2,170.
